About A. Sechler

A. Sechler is a scholar working on Plant Science, Molecular Biology, Cell Biology, Insect Science and Horticulture, having authored 23 papers that have together received 714 indexed citations. Recurring topics across this work include Plant Pathogenic Bacteria Studies (17 papers), Genomics and Phylogenetic Studies (7 papers), Plant Pathogens and Fungal Diseases (6 papers), Phytoplasmas and Hemiptera pathogens (6 papers), Plant-Microbe Interactions and Immunity (5 papers), Plant Disease Resistance and Genetics (2 papers), Legume Nitrogen Fixing Symbiosis (2 papers) and Insect symbiosis and bacterial influences (2 papers). The work is most often cited by research in Horticulture (68 citations), Plant Science (654 citations), Insect Science (106 citations), Cell Biology (137 citations) and Endocrinology (18 citations). A. Sechler has collaborated with scholars based in United States, Russia and Ireland. Frequent co-authors include N. W. Schaad, Elena Postnikova, Anne K. Vidaver, Irina V. Agarkova, David A. Knorr, Yvette Berthier‐Schaad, William L. Schneider, Norman W. Schaad, А. Н. Игнатов and V. D. Damsteegt. Their work appears in journals such as Phytopathology, Plant Disease, Systematic and Applied Microbiology, Plant Pathology and PROTEOMICS.
